    Douglas Craig Emhoff [2] was born on October 13, 1964, in the Brooklyn borough of New York City, the son of Jewish parents, Barbara (née Kanzer) and Michael Emhoff. [3] His ancestors moved to the United States from Gorlice, Poland, circa 1899 due to persecution.

    Kamala Devi Harris (/ ˈ k ɑː m ə l ə ˈ d eɪ v i / ⓘ KAH-mə-lə DAY-vee; [2] born October 20, 1964) is an American politician and attorney who is the 49th and current vice president of the United States since 2021 under President Joe Biden.

    Deadpool & Wolverine is a 2024 American superhero film based on Marvel Comics featuring the characters Deadpool and Wolverine.Produced by Marvel Studios, Maximum Effort, and 21 Laps Entertainment, and distributed by Walt Disney Studios Motion Pictures, it is the 34th film in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U) and the sequel to Deadpool (2016) and Deadpool 2 (2018).

    Menu showing a list of desserts in a pizzeria. In a restaurant, the menu is a list of food and beverages offered to customers and the prices.     Jill Tracy Jacobs Biden [1] (née Jacobs; born June 3, 1951) is an American educator who has been the first lady of the United States since 2021 as the wife of President Joe Biden.
